The Easiest Way to Get Rid of Spyware

If you think that web sites that have pretty looking graphics and an eTrust seal are always safe, well, I have news for you.
These sites are not always safe! Recently, a national study was done, and it found that 97 per cent of people who go on the internet can download spyware, malware, trojans and other types of intruders very easily, without even knowing it.
A quiz was given to to computer users, who were tested to see how much they knew about spyware detection.
Users were shown two sites, and they were asked to choose which one was safe.
Later, sites that feature software sharing were displayed, and users were told to choose the site that was free of spyware.
65 per cent selected a site that was loaded with spyware, even though the site told them that their computer would have spyware loaded on it.
Well, sort of.
See, spyware disclaimers are often buried in the fine print, so those who put these nasty intruders there are not liable legally.
But seriously, who bothers to read all of that fine print? The fact is, 91 percent of people who have a P- C and use the internet have spyware on their computers.
It is virtually impossible to detect these intruders, and getting it off your computer yourself is even more challenging.
